Transaction 52aac32996d58fde7540c8bee2bbbccaf4d9d2bf7e4e4ffd6c45c4514e2fb614
2 Input
2 Outputs
- 52aac32996d58fde7540c8bee2bbbccaf4d9d2bf7e4e4ffd6c45c4514e2fb614:0
- 52aac32996d58fde7540c8bee2bbbccaf4d9d2bf7e4e4ffd6c45c4514e2fb614:1
value 18464971
address 35KMfBqg3YQrFZ8Bjyr26UmTcqQK6RFnDM
value 372956
address 33G96rXu25Q6Grxp4EYPHgXe9cJTNi8rM1